Ugly Nora wrote:Didja ever make the one with the gong? If so, what differences do you hear between the two, which one you like better?
yeah, the gong turned out great. I got sidetracked and never made a demo of it....been meaning to bring it back home if I can remember :grumpy: The sheet metal turned out really neat too. I though it would be a good idea to try different placement/mountings on it before drilling on the gong but it didn't really tell me much. I think this size resonator is just way overkill for that thin piece of metal, and I can barely tap the amp open before the sheet metal takes off and starts adding thunder sounds. Now, that's actually pretty awesome and I just made another demo to show what I'm talking about. In that first demo I tried to keep it from going off too much but you can still hear it now and again. I'll try to make a demo with the gong sooner than later.

sooo, here is a listen to two Ieaskul F Mobenthey Fourses modulating two Denum's. Fourses have four oscillators bouncing off one another, I patch the top two from each Fourses into the linear bounds/bounce on the two Denum, then also patch the bottom two oscillators into the exponential bounds/bounce inputs on the Denum. Then I flip toggles and wiggle knobs. Each oscillator on the Fourses has a three way toggle which changes the range of their output from audio/lfo/cv. Pretty nuts.
